In the early days of extraction, the goal was simple: isolate as much THC as possible. As the industry has matured, it’s become clear that cannabinoids are only part of the equation. The defining character of an extract lives in its volatile compounds.

Terpenes get most of the attention, and for good reason. They drive the citrus, pine, gas, and fruit notes that define a profile. But they aren’t the whole picture.

What makes an extract feel “alive” is the broader mix of volatile compounds that rarely show up on standard lab panels. Esters, alcohols, aldehydes, ketones, sulfur compounds, and other trace volatiles all contribute to aroma and flavor in ways that terpene percentages alone cannot fully explain.

These compounds can exist at extremely low concentrations and still dominate the sensory experience. Human olfaction isn’t linear. A molecule can be minor by percentage and still major by impact.

That’s why two extracts with nearly identical terpene panels can smell and taste completely different. A COA might show both as limonene, caryophyllene, and humulene dominant, but it won’t capture the full volatile fingerprint responsible for the actual experience.

In Oregon’s competitive cannabis market, terpene retention has become one of the clearest indicators of quality. Consumers are starting to look beyond THC percentage. Budtenders are comparing COAs. The “highest THC wins” era is slowly losing ground.

Our data backs that up. Across real production runs, terpene content regularly lands in the mid-single digits, with stronger expressions pushing higher when everything is done right. That’s not theory. That’s what actually shows up on the sheet.

Terpenes, however, are inherently unstable. They are among the first compounds to degrade or evaporate when exposed to heat, oxygen, or time. So what actually determines whether an extract keeps its flavor and aroma?

What Determines Terpene Retention

Terpene preservation isn’t luck. It’s process control. Every stage either protects volatile compounds or degrades them.

From harvest to final storage, two variables dominate everything else: temperature and time.

Other variables matter, but they all operate through those two levers.

Temperature Control: The First and Biggest Lever

Terpenes are volatile by definition. Many monoterpenes begin evaporating at relatively low temperatures, well before cannabinoids are affected.

  • Excessive heat during extraction drives off top-note terpenes first
  • High-temperature purging accelerates loss and chemical degradation
  • Processing above roughly 180–220°F rapidly strips volatile fractions

Vacuum systems allow operators to lower boiling points and purge at reduced temperatures, which is why they are critical in hydrocarbon extraction workflows.

Low-temperature processes consistently produce louder, more expressive extracts. Heat doesn’t just remove terpenes. It reshapes the profile into something flatter and less defined.

Time and Exposure: Death by Accumulation

Even with good temperature control, time works against you.

  • Longer processing windows increase terpene loss
  • Repeated heat cycles degrade volatile compounds
  • Open-air handling introduces oxygen and accelerates oxidation

Terpene loss is cumulative. No single step ruins the extract. A series of small inefficiencies will.

Vacuum and Purging: Precision or Overkill

Vacuum is essential, but it’s easy to misuse.

  • Deep vacuum lowers boiling points, including those of terpenes
  • Aggressive purging can strip desirable volatiles along with residual solvent
  • Poor temperature control during purge compounds the problem

Effective purging is about balance. Remove solvents without unnecessarily sacrificing volatile compounds.

Storage: The Quiet Saboteur

You can execute everything correctly and still degrade the final product through poor storage.

Terpenes degrade through:

  • Oxygen exposure
  • Heat fluctuations
  • Light, especially UV
  • Time

Best practices are simple and frequently ignored:

  • Store cool and stable
  • Minimize headspace
  • Use airtight containers
  • Avoid repeated opening cycles

A well-made extract can lose its edge quickly if storage is sloppy.

What the Numbers Actually Tell You

Lab data isn’t perfect, but it’s still useful when interpreted correctly. Since we’re operating in the Oregon market, that’s what data we’ll focus on.

  • 5–12% total terpenes = strong aromatic expression
  • 3–5% = moderate, still expressive depending on composition
  • <3% = often muted unless terpenes are reintroduced

More important than total percentage:

  • Terpene diversity
  • Balance between monoterpenes and sesquiterpenes
  • Alignment between aroma and COA

If a product tests high in terpenes but smells weak, something failed between production, packaging, and storage.

Final Thoughts: Chemistry Drives Experience

Terpene preservation is not a branding decision. It’s the result of disciplined process control.

If you want extracts that actually smell and taste like the plant they came from:

  • Control temperature aggressively
  • Minimize time and exposure
  • Use selective extraction methods
  • Handle vacuum and purge conditions carefully
  • Store the final product like it matters

None of this is theoretical. It shows up immediately when you open the jar. A well-preserved extract announces itself before you even take a dab. A poorly preserved one needs excuses.
